Unfortunately, it’s a story we’ve had to tell too many times before. A fire in the predawn hours has left seven Belize City residents homeless and without most of their belongings. Today Belize Electricity Limited (BEL) has responded to a press release sent out by the United Democratic Party on Wednesday. BEL says they feel it is necessary to clarify and correct the UDP release. Tonight it appears that one local hotel has escaped a financial noose even after it was put up for auction. News Five has confirmed that the Belize Biltmore Plaza, owned by Caribbean Shores Development Limited, was slated to be auctioned off on Thursday. For sometime now the Mercy Kitchen in Belize City has been providing senior citizens with two full meals a day.
